Job PurposeElectricity Transmission (ET) is navigating through an exciting time as we evolve to meet net-zero targets for 2050. Joining us as an Asset Management Engineer you will support the development of all aspects of the lifecycle for electricity transmission equipment in the required area of T&D Air or Gas-insulated Switchgear
- Experience of specification, design, development, maintenance and/or lifetime management of transmission & distribution gas-insulated substations and their associated equipment.
Focussing on transmission level voltage equipment between 400kV and 33kV, working at the heart of National Grid Electricity Transmission's Asset Management and Engineering department in Asset Operations to meet the aspirations of Net Zero and the delivery of the Great Grid Upgrade.
What you'll doAs an Asset Management Engineer within the Asset Management - Substation HV Plant team, you will drive the development of all aspects of Substation HV T&D Air or Gas-insulated Switchgear assets lifecycle within your specific area of technical expertise (depending on background/experience). Ensuring we support the delivery of our RIIO T2/T3 regulatory period commitments and develop the Asset intervention and net zero strategies for RIIO T3/T4 and beyond to meet strategic and business objectives.
- Provide detailed, technical and asset management knowledge in either area above depending on experience.
- Be involved across the whole lifecycle of the specific asset category.
- Create and amend policies, procedures, technical specifications, work specifications, internal standards and technical guidance within area of expertise
- Support the development of the Technical Strategy and identify the need for appropriate intervention strategies across our HV plant portfolio and identify innovation opportunities
- Support the development of virtual team working to take advantage of technology and methodology developments within specific area of technical expertise
- Undertake Type Registration activities in line with relevant procedures with limited supervision
- Support external engagement - Regulatory & Energy Industry Understanding
- Represent National Grid on appropriate national and international committees influencing the direction of national policy, standard or specifications
- Support other members of the team
